Gracia Zabala is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ology and Biochem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Gracia Zabala has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 718 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Plant Science, 10 papers in Molecular Biology and 1 paper in Biochemistry. Recurrent topics in Gracia Zabala’s work include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(7 papers), Plant Molecular Biology Research (6 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(4 papers). Gracia Zabala is often cited by papers focused on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(7 papers), Plant Molecular Biology Research (6 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(4 papers). Gracia Zabala collaborates with scholars based in United States. Gracia Zabala's co-authors include Lila O. Vodkin, Virginia Walbot, Jigyasa H. Tuteja, Steven J. Clough and Matthew E. Hudson and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and PLoS ONE.
